### Bar Charts: A Compact Representation of Relative Sizes

Bar charts are among the first visual tools that many of us encounter when learning about data visualization. As their name suggests, bars represent the data, and their lengths or heights correspond to the values being depicted. This straightforward format makes them highly effective for comparing different values across categories.

#### Uses and Benefits of Bar Charts

1. **Comparing Large Sets of Data**: Bar charts can effectively display a large number of categories, making it easy to discern trends and compare values.

2. **Facilitating Trend Analysis**: By stackingbar charts, it’s possible to visualize trends within subcategories or over time.

3. **Easy Consumption of Information**: They are user-friendly and can be quickly understood by a broad audience.

4. **Adaptability**: Bar charts can be adapted to display different data types, such as discrete or continuous data.

#### Limitations of Bar Charts

1. **Overload of Data**: High complexity can make a bar chart difficult to read and interpret.

2. **Misinterpretation of Patterns**: Sometimes, an audience might mistakenly attribute patterns or trends to the data when it’s just a side effect of the chart design.

### Line Charts: A Smooth Journey Through Time

Line charts are excellent for illustrating trends over time. They convey a clear and continuous story that can track changes across days, weeks, months, or even years.

#### Uses and Benefits of Line Charts

1. **Trend Analysis**: Line charts are particularly handy for showing how data changes over time, helping to identify patterns and trends.

2. **Showcasing Relationships**: They can be used to compare two datasets and observe how they interact with each other.

3. **Adaptability**: While ideal for time series data, line charts can also be used in many other scenarios depending on the data structure.

#### Limitations of Line Charts

1. **Overhead of Information**: While they’re wonderful for showing trends, too many data points can make the chart overly complicated and thus more challenging to understand.

2. **Overlooking Seasonality**: Line charts can sometimes mask the impact of seasonal variations when displayed over extended time frames.

### Area Charts: The Breadth of Information

Area charts are similar to line charts, as they also plot values on the vertical axis and connect them to form a line. However, the area below the line is colored, which is where they differentiate themselves significantly.

#### Uses and Benefits of Area Charts

1. **Highlighting Magnitude**: The area under the line emphasizes the magnitude of the data, helping viewers quickly identify significant values.

2. **Comparison of Multiple Series**: It’s easier to compare multiple series overlaid on the same chart due to the continuous space between lines.

3. **Integration with Data**: Area charts can elegantly integrate other types of data, such as averages or medians, into the same visualization for added insights.

#### Limitations of Area Charts

1. **Complex Interpretation**: The overlapping of multiple series can lead to confusion, making it difficult to discern individual lines.

2. **Not Ideal for Large Data Sets**: They may not be effective when dealing with large datasets, as the information may become cluttered and less readable.
